What Is Content Management System

Explore Its Advantages

A Content Management System (CMS) is a software device that allows you to provide, control, and alter virtual information without having delicate technical competencies.

Ease of Use

CMS platforms are intended to be person-friendly, allowing every person with little to no technical know-how to control internet site content material effortlessly.

Content Editing and Publishing

Content creators can use a CMS to effortlessly expand, edit, and submit content without having to recognize HTML or other coding languages.

Customization and Flexibility

Most CMS systems provide a diverse set of themes, templates, and plugins/extensions that permit customers to customize the appearance and capability of their sites.

Scalability

CMS platforms are scalable. This means they can accommodate the growth of a website or digital platform over the years.
